How do you bathe a pet rabbit safely?

Bathing a rabbit should be done with caution, as rabbits are sensitive animals. It is generally not recommended to give them a full bath unless absolutely necessary. Instead, you can spot-clean your pet rabbit using a damp cloth or unscented baby wipes. Only bathe a rabbit in water if advised by a veterinarian and use a shallow basin with lukewarm water. Make sure to keep the rabbit calm during the process and dry it thoroughly afterward to prevent any health issues.
